Church of Santa Cruz-Museo de Semana Santa, Medina de Rioseco, Catholic church and Holy Week museum in Medina de Rioseco, Spain.

The Church of Santa Cruz is a stone building with geometric lines that embodies the Herrerian architectural principles of the Spanish Renaissance. Its interior houses a museum displaying a collection of sculptures and religious objects connected to the city's Holy Week traditions.

The church was built in the 16th century following the strict geometric style popular among Spanish architects of that era. It became part of the broader religious and cultural infrastructure that shaped Medina de Rioseco during the Renaissance.

The collection displays religious sculptures by artists like Juan de Juni and Gregorio Fernández, created specifically for the processions during Holy Week. These works reflect the artistic tradition of the region that continues to shape local celebrations today.

The museum is typically open in the early afternoon on weekdays and in the evening on weekends, so check opening hours before visiting. Access to the church and museum is straightforward, though visitors should allow time to explore the collection.

The museum displays not just static objects but documents the living tradition of Holy Week processions that have taken place in this town for centuries. This connection between ancient artworks and a practice still carried out today makes the place exceptional.
